I have an automatic 2019 Audi A3.

Sometimes when my right foot lifts off the accelerator to press down on the brake pedal, it hits the side
of the brake pedal instead of rising cleanly above it. This has caused my braking to be slightly delayed at times.
Now I tend to brake well ahead of when I need to stop, to guarantee that I am on the brake pedal.

Can the brake pedal height be adjusted (by an Audi dealer) i.e. lowered slightly?

Thanks,



bern
 
I've checked what pictures I can see in Elsawin & it looks like a fixed length push rod from the servo to brake pedal with no clevis type for the fixture at the pedal, just being a ball & socket design.

Simple answer is no, you can't adjust the brake pedal height.

However, I'm sure if you were determined anything is possible ;)
 
with that new info you can prob jerry-rig some spacers in there to push the whole unit back a little. but remember that if you have less travel before it hits the ground, when the unit fails you won't have the extra space that would have been there to stop in an emergency.
